  3. Atlas Express Ltd. v Kafco -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Atlas_Express_Ltd._v_Kafco

    On 18 November 1986, Atlas sent an empty truck to Kafco, with a letter saying if a higher charge was not agreed to, the truck would leave empty. Kafco would go broke without the contract, so they "felt compelled to sign". Later, Kafco refused to pay, and argued there was economic duress, and also no new consideration.

  8. Atlas Air -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Atlas_Air

    Atlas Air, Inc. is a major American cargo airline, passenger charter airline, and aircraft lessor based in Purchase, New York. It is a wholly owned subsidiary of Atlas Air Worldwide Holdings . Atlas Air is the world's largest operator of the Boeing 747 aircraft, with a total fleet of 54 of this specific fleet type.

  9. Atlas/Seaboard Comics -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Atlas/Seaboard_Comics

    Atlas/Seaboard Comics is a line of comic books published by the American company Seaboard Periodicals in the 1970s. Though the line was published under the brand Atlas Comics , comic book historians and collectors refer to it as Atlas/Seaboard Comics to differentiate it from the 1950s Atlas Comics , a predecessor of Marvel Comics .
